Problem description: If you look at the screenshot, you can see that words do not fit into the left field of Options window (Tools -> Options...) in Russian localisation. Also it is in EN localisation.
It is not in 4.3.5 version.

Comment 7 Caolán McNamara 2015-01-13 11:31:20 UTC
its probably better to use set_width_request(approximate_char_width() * nChars)) instead of using pixels in the .ui (ideally the .ui would have a char width measurement, but it doesn't) because the 240 pixel width won't "scale" with larger fonts
